1. Structure: How Fabric Shapes the Outfit
Fabric determines structure.
Firm fabrics—like brocade or thicker woven Ankara—hold their shape. They create clean lines, sharp edges, and a more tailored look. These fabrics are perfect when you want an outfit to feel powerful, formal, and intentional.
Softer fabrics—such as chiffon, crepe, or lightweight silk blends—collapse gently against the body. They allow the outfit to flow instead of stand stiffly, creating movement and softness.
👉 Same design, different fabric = different silhouette.

2. Drape: How Fabric Falls on the Body
Drape is how fabric falls and flows when worn.
A fabric with good drape moves naturally with the body, creating elegance and ease. Poor drape can make even a beautiful design feel awkward or stiff.
This is why two kaftans with the same cut can feel completely different when worn—one may glide effortlessly, while the other feels rigid.

3. Weight: How Fabric Changes the Mood
Fabric weight affects the visual weight of an outfit.
-
Heavier fabrics feel grounded, formal, and structured—perfect for events, celebrations, or when you want a commanding presence.
-
Lighter fabrics feel airy, relaxed, and breathable—ideal for brunch, travel, or warm weather styling.
Even with the same cut, fabric weight can turn an outfit from casual to elevated.

4. Movement: How the Outfit Comes Alive
Movement is where fabric truly shows its personality.
Some fabrics sway with every step. Others stay still and composed. Movement affects how natural, comfortable, and confident an outfit feels.
This is why boubous and kaftans remain timeless—they allow fabric to move freely, creating effortless elegance without trying too hard.

5. Finish: Matte vs Shine
The finish of a fabric changes everything.
-
Matte fabrics feel calm, understated, and refined.
-
Shiny fabrics draw attention, reflect light, and add drama.
